What affects the price

When you call for electrical help, a few things influence the final bill. The biggest factor is the scope of the project—swapping out a basic outlet is a quick task, while rewiring a room or upgrading an old panel requires much more labor and time. The age of your home also plays a role, as older wiring often needs extra care to meet current safety standards. Parts and material quality also change the total cost. What are the different types of electrical wire used in Jacksonville homes?

In Jacksonville homes, you'll commonly find copper electrical wire. The thickness, or gauge, of the wire depends on its intended use and the electrical load it will carry. For general lighting and outlets, smaller gauges are used, while larger gauges are needed for high-demand appliances. It's crucial to use the correct type and gauge to prevent overheating and ensure safety. Licensed pros understand these specifications.

How important are electrical insulators for Jacksonville's climate?

Electrical insulators are vital in Jacksonville's humid and often wet climate. They prevent electrical current from escaping the intended path, which is crucial for preventing short circuits and electrical shocks. Materials like porcelain or specialized plastics are used for their insulating properties. Proper insulation protects your wiring from moisture damage and corrosion, ensuring system integrity. What's involved in installing an electric car charger for home use in Jacksonville?

Installing an electric car charger at home in Jacksonville involves assessing your home's electrical panel capacity and the desired charger type. A licensed electrician will determine the correct wiring and circuit breaker needed to safely power the charger. They ensure the installation meets all local codes and safety standards. What should I look for in an outdoor electrical box in Jacksonville?

For Jacksonville's climate, an outdoor electrical box must be weatherproof and durable. Look for boxes made of corrosion-resistant materials like high-impact plastic or coated metal. They should have secure lids and gaskets to prevent water and pest intrusion. Proper installation by a qualified electrician is crucial to protect wiring and connections from the elements.
